Cool, thanks for the link.

> The Libreboot D16 desktop with the D16 motherboard, one Opteron 6272, 16GB of RAM, and the NVIDIA GTX 660 Ti / 670 is marked up at £3,450.00 (~$4188 USD) while the D16 server with 1 CPU and 16GB of RAM is £3,450.00 or up to £5,600.00 ($6800 USD) if wanting two of the Interlagos CPUs and 128GB of RAM.

> If wanting to build the system yourself and flash Libreboot on the same motherboard, you can likely build the system for around $1k USD or less: $400~500 for the KGPE-D16 at the aforementioned links, the CPUs for $16+, a couple hundred or less depending upon how much DDR3 RDIMMs you want, etc.

So as a complete system flashed with libreboot it costs almost as much as the Talos system would have, but it also has the benefit of existing.

>>58429899
The backstory of the leap from the 64-core Ephiphany IV to the 1024 core EV is DARPA wanted something suited to low-power, scaleable machine learning and smart image/video processing.

The intereraccessible SRAM is an interesting design, and EV is 64 bit. They have no provision for a GPU or any of the myriad of ASICs found in say, an i7. If a new CPU ISA is to prove itself to the world, it first needs to prove that it can be used as a CPU. The desktop is often the last place innovation in this field is made, simply because it is predicated on the underlying (mixed computation and useful throughput here) technologies proving themselves.

tl;dr CPU has to prove it can be a good CPU in high-budget environment, and will get to lower-budget later.
